A Death Cafe is an event where people drink tea, eat cake and discuss death.

At a Death Cafe people drink tea, eat cake and discuss death. Our aim is to increase awareness of death to help people make the most of their (finite) lives.

Death Cafe write up: Swanage Death Cafe

Posted by peterneall on April 15, 2024, 2:05 a.m.

Seven guests, a host and a facilitator met on the afternoon of Friday April 12th 2024 at The Hub in Swanage.

The facilitator introduced the event with a short history of Death Cafe's and an agreement on Ground-rules. 

THen the discusion included all the guests and topics ranging from fear r of death, terror in the face of it, the joy of being fully present at the death of a loved one nd so on. One guest commented on the joy of simply being able to speak of death without being told to stop.
